CORINTHIA. Corinth. Tiberius, 14-37. (Bronze, 21 mm, 4.49 g, 6 h), struck under the magistrates Lucius Castricius Regulus and Publius Caninius Agrippa, 21-22. [P CANINIO AGRIPPA IIVIR QVINQ] Bare head of Drusus Minor or Tiberius(?) to right. Rev. [L] CASTR[ICIO REGVLO IIVIR] QVIN / COR Livia, veiled, seated to right, holding patera in right hand and scepter in left. BMC 523. RPC I, 1149. Extremely rare; earthen highlights. Good fine.

From a Swedish collection.
